フォトショップフィルタープラグインSDKのメイク方法(VC++5.0)
exampleの下に*.mdb(VC++4.0用)があるのでそのまま読みこんでビルド。
コンパイル中...
ColorMunger.c
..\..\Common\Headers.h\PIUtilities.h(16) : fatal error C1083: インクルード ファイルがオープンできません。'Types.h': No such file or directory
ColorMungerScripting.c
..\..\Common\Headers.h\PIUtilities.h(16) : fatal error C1083: インクルード ファイルがオープンできません。'Types.h': No such file or directory
ColorMungerUIWin.c
..\..\Common\Headers.h\PIUtilities.h(16) : fatal error C1083: インクルード ファイルがオープンできません。'Types.h': No such file or directory
PIUtilities.c
fatal error C1083: ソース ファイルがオープンできません。'C:\Adobe\Photoshop SDK\Examples\Common\Sources.c\PIUtilities.c': No such file or directory
WinDialogUtils.c
fatal error C1083: ソース ファイルがオープンできません。'C:\Adobe\Photoshop SDK\Examples\Common\Sources.c\WinDialogUtils.c': No such file or directory
WinFileUtils.c
fatal error C1083: ソース ファイルがオープンできません。'C:\Adobe\Photoshop SDK\Examples\Common\Sources.c\WinFileUtils.c': No such file or directory
WinUtilities.c
fatal error C1083: ソース ファイルがオープンできません。'C:\Adobe\Photoshop SDK\Examples\Common\Sources.c\WinUtilities.c': No such file or directory
cl.exe の実行エラー
ColorMunger.8bf - エラー 7、警告 0
とりあえずソース中のを変更。*.makファイル中の"C:\Adobe\Photoshop SDK\"を"C:\Adobe\Adobe Photoshop 4.0 SDK"に変更(don't editと書いてあるけど、まぁ仕方無し(笑))。以上でビルドは成功しました。
C:\Adobe\Adobe Photoshop 4.0 SDK\Readme.txtに色々注意点が書いてあるので読むべし。
翻訳サイトで訳すと、
Visual C++4.0ユーザ--------------------
Visual C++4.0およびマイクロソフト・ディベロッパー・スタジオは、バージョン2.0よりプロジェクトを異なって扱います。
Visual C++4.0メイクファイルが含まれていました。それらは40.mdpとしてリストされます。Visual C++4.0の中のプロジェクトを開くために.mdpファイルをダブルクリックしてください。
ディレクトリーは更新します-- コンパイルする前に、読まれた!小さなエラーをTypes.h(それはMSDEV/INCLUDES/sysに一般に位置する)のような標準のヘッダーを捜すとしてもよい、どれ、あるVC4.0の上で、インストールする、自動的に得ない、ディレクトリー・パスの中に置きます。これを固定するためには、オプションに行ってください...そして、あなたのディレクトリーにパスを加えてください。
さらに、Visual C++4.0はプロジェクト・フォルダー内にないファイルに相対的なパスを思い出すことが好きではありません。
その手段、それ、ファイル、PIUTILITIES.C、WINDIALOGUTILS.CおよびWINUTILITIES.C、どれ、example/common/Sources.cに駐在する、正確にリンクしてはならない、いつ、あなた、1位.MDPプロジェクトを開きます。
これの修正:1. PIUtilitiesを削除します。それらをhilightingし押すことによるあなたのプロジェクト・ファイル・リストからのC、WinDialogUtils.cおよびWinUtilities.cは削除します。
2. プロジェクト・メニューから、「プロジェクトにファイルを加えてください」...そして、example/commonフォルダーからファイルを後ろに中へ加えてください。
Visual C++4.2ユーザ--------------------
Visual C++4.2 DLLは、VC DLLをロードしないマシンによって認識可能なプラグ・インを作成しません。私たちはバージョン4.1以前を使用することを推奨します。
だそうです。
フォトショップフィルタへ戻る
フリーソフトウェアへ戻る
ホームページへ戻る
お手紙はnekora@mapletown.netまで☆